// Copyright (c) 2009-2010 Satoshi Nakamoto
// Copyright (c) 2009-2016 The Bitcoin Core developers
// Distributed under the MIT software license, see the accompanying
// file COPYING or http://www.opensource.org/licenses/mit-license.php.
#if defined(HAVE_CONFIG_H)
#include "config/gridcoin-config.h"
#endif
#include "chainparams.h"
#include "chainparamsbase.h"
#include "util.h"
#include "net.h"
#include "txdb.h"
#include "wallet/walletdb.h"
#include "init.h"
#include "rpc/server.h"
#include "rpc/client.h"
#include "ui_interface.h"
#include "gridcoin/upgrade.h"
#include <boost/thread.hpp>
#include <boost/algorithm/string/predicate.hpp>
#include <stdio.h>
extern bool fQtActive;
//////////////////////////////////////////////////////////////////////////////
//
// Start
//
bool AppInit(int argc, char* argv[])
{
#ifdef WIN32
util::WinCmdLineArgs winArgs;
std::tie(argc, argv) = winArgs.get();
#endif
SetupEnvironment();
SetupServerArgs();
// Note every function above the InitLogging() call must use fprintf or similar.
ThreadHandlerPtr threads = std::make_shared<ThreadHandler>();
bool fRet = false;
try
{
//
// Parameters
//
// If Qt is used, parameters/gridcoinresearch.conf are parsed in qt/bitcoin.cpp's main()
std::string error;
if (!gArgs.ParseParameters(argc, argv, error)) {
tfm::format(std::cerr, "Error parsing command line arguments: %s\n", error);
return EXIT_FAILURE;
}
if (HelpRequested(gArgs))
{
// First part of help message is specific to bitcoind / RPC client
std::string strUsage = _("Gridcoin version") + " " + FormatFullVersion() + "\n\n" +
_("Usage:") + "\n" +
" gridcoinresearchd [options] " + "\n" +
" gridcoinresearchd [options] <command> [params] " + _("Send command to -server or gridcoinresearchd") + "\n" +
" gridcoinresearchd [options] help " + _("List commands") + "\n" +
" gridcoinresearchd [options] help <command> " + _("Get help for a command") + "\n";
strUsage += "\n" + gArgs.GetHelpMessage();
tfm::format(std::cout, "%s", strUsage);
return EXIT_SUCCESS;
}
if (gArgs.IsArgSet("-version"))
{
fprintf(stdout, "%s", VersionMessage().c_str());
return false;
}
if (!CheckDataDirOption()) {
tfm::format(std::cerr, "Error: Specified data directory \"%s\" does not exist.\n", gArgs.GetArg("-datadir", ""));
return EXIT_FAILURE;
}
/** Check mainnet config file first in case testnet is set there and not in command line args **/
SelectParams(CBaseChainParams::MAIN);
// Currently unused.
std::string error_msg;
if (!gArgs.ReadConfigFiles(error_msg, true))
{
tfm::format(std::cerr, "Config file cannot be parsed. Cannot continue.\n");
exit(1);
}
SelectParams(gArgs.IsArgSet("-testnet") ? CBaseChainParams::TESTNET : CBaseChainParams::MAIN);
// reread config file after correct chain is selected
if (!gArgs.ReadConfigFiles(error_msg, true))
{
tfm::format(std::cerr, "Config file cannot be parsed. Cannot continue.\n");
exit(1);
}
if (!gArgs.InitSettings(error)) {
tfm::format(std::cerr, "Error initializing settings.\n");
exit(1);
}
// Command-line RPC - single commands execute and exit.
for (int i = 1; i < argc; i++)
if (!IsSwitchChar(argv[i][0]) && !boost::algorithm::istarts_with(argv[i], "gridcoinresearchd"))
fCommandLine = true;
if (fCommandLine)
{
int ret = CommandLineRPC(argc, argv);
exit(ret);
}
// Initialize logging as early as possible.
InitLogging();
// Make sure a user does not request snapshotdownload and resetblockchaindata at same time!
if (gArgs.IsArgSet("-snapshotdownload") && gArgs.IsArgSet("-resetblockchaindata"))
{
tfm::format(std::cerr, "-snapshotdownload and -resetblockchaindata cannot be used in conjunction");
exit(1);
}
// Check to see if the user requested a snapshot and we are not running TestNet!
if (gArgs.IsArgSet("-snapshotdownload") && !gArgs.IsArgSet("-testnet"))
{
GRC::Upgrade snapshot;
// Let's check make sure gridcoin is not already running in the data directory.
// Use new probe feature
if (!LockDirectory(GetDataDir(), ".lock", false))
{
tfm::format(std::cerr, "Cannot obtain a lock on data directory %s. Gridcoin is probably already running.",
GetDataDir().string().c_str());
exit(1);
}
else
{
try
{
snapshot.SnapshotMain();
}
catch (std::runtime_error& e)
{
LogPrintf("Snapshot Downloader: Runtime exception occurred in SnapshotMain() (%s)", e.what());
snapshot.DeleteSnapshot();
exit(1);
}
}
// Delete snapshot file
snapshot.DeleteSnapshot();
}
// Check to see if the user requested to reset blockchain data -- We allow reset blockchain data on testnet, but not a snapshot download.
if (gArgs.IsArgSet("-resetblockchaindata"))
{
GRC::Upgrade resetblockchain;
// Let's check make sure gridcoin is not already running in the data directory.
if (!LockDirectory(GetDataDir(), ".lock", false))
{
tfm::format(std::cerr, "Cannot obtain a lock on data directory %s. Gridcoin is probably already running.", GetDataDir().string().c_str());
exit(1);
}
else
{
if (resetblockchain.ResetBlockchainData())
LogPrintf("ResetBlockchainData: success");
else
{
LogPrintf("ResetBlockchainData: failed to clean up blockchain data");
std::string inftext = resetblockchain.ResetBlockchainMessages(resetblockchain.CleanUp);
tfm::format(std::cerr, "%s", inftext.c_str());
exit(1);
}
}
}
LogPrintf("AppInit");
fRet = AppInit2(threads);
}
catch (std::exception& e) {
LogPrintf("AppInit()Exception1");
PrintException(&e, "AppInit()");
} catch (...) {
LogPrintf("AppInit()Exception2");
PrintException(nullptr, "AppInit()");
}
if(fRet)
{
while (!ShutdownRequested())
MilliSleep(500);
}
Shutdown(nullptr);
// delete thread handler
threads->interruptAll();
threads->removeAll();
threads.reset();
return fRet;
}
extern void noui_connect();
int main(int argc, char* argv[])
{
// Reinit default timer to ensure it is zeroed out at the start of main.
g_timer.InitTimer("default", false);
bool fRet = false;
// Set global boolean to indicate intended absence of GUI to core...
fQtActive = false;
// Connect bitcoind signal handlers
noui_connect();
fRet = AppInit(argc, argv);
if (fRet && fDaemon)
return 0;
return 1;
}
